Jump to content
php.lv forumi

vimba

Reģistrētie lietotāji
  • Posts

    17
  • Joined

  • Last visited

Posts posted by vimba

  1. Gribēju prasīt zinātājiem vai datubāzē obligāti jābūt visās tabulās kādam auto_increment laukam?

    varianti:

    a) recommended,

    b) obligāti,

    c) pietiek tā vietā ar vienu vai vairākiem unikāliem (unique) laukiem,

    d) ?

     

    Kādi ir 'best practice' šajā jautājumā?

  2. Lūk paraugs ar diviem browseriem, saliec papildus vēl nosacījumus. Bet brīdinu, šis ir overkills, it sevišķi ja daudz datu un bieži izpildīsi. Neuzņemos nekādu atbildību par nelietderīgu resursu izmantošanu :)

    Regulārai izpildīšanai, iepriekš tika ieteikti tie prātīgākie varianti. Bet ja vajag vienai reizei, tad būs ok variants.

    SELECT (CASE WHEN (user_agent LIKE '%Firefox%') THEN 'Firefox' WHEN (user_agent LIKE '%Chrome%') THEN 'Chrome' ELSE 'Other' END) AS browser, count(*) FROM tabula GROUP BY browser ORDER BY count(*) DESC

    Tanks! Kaut ko šitādu tieši vajadzēja "uz fikso pārskriet pāri". Mazliet pielaboju un darbojas tā kā patreiz vajag.

    Paldies visiem!

  3. vajag lobīt to infu ārā, pirms ievietot tabulā un katrai informācijai (OS, browseris, utt), pēc kuras vēlas kaut ko kārtot, atlasīt, utt, taisīt savu kolonnu un tajā glabāt to informāciju.

     

    OFFT: Es biku nesaprotu, atbildot uz postu "ne pa ķeksi" jūs vienkārši "es esmu krutais postētājs" kaut kādus punktus tādā veidā vācat?

    Jautājums bija izvilkt no _esošiem_ datiem infu, nevis kā būtu bijis pareizāk/mazāk pareizi...

  4. INSERT INTO `table` (`user_agent`) VALUES('$user_agent')

     

    SELECT COUNT (`id`), `user_agent` FROM `table` GROUP BY `user_agent`

     

    Nu ja tu būtu kaut reizi to pats darījis, tad redzētu, ka tik vienkārši vis nav, jo šādi nu nekādīgi atsevišķi OS un Browser izvilkt nevar. Pie tam Browseriem un dažreiz OS ir arī milzum daudz versijas...

  5. Dots: Gara, PHP ģererēta HTML tabula ar scrollbaru. Katrai rindiņai piesiets unikāls <a> "enkurs".

    Vajag: Aktivizējot konkrēto "enkuru", to vajag izvietot pa vidu, nevis pašā lapas augšā, kā tas notiek automātiski. Vajadzīga IE6/FF/Safari/O savietojamība.

    <ceru, ka es pareizajā topicā ierakstīju... :| >

  6. Es šadām vajadzībām uztaisu kādu skriptu kas vnk brutāli visam iet cauri un taisa insertus datubāzē ar vajadzīgajām vērtībām apstrādājot tās...

    Nu jā, caur PHP/watever jau to izveikt ir elementāri, gribējās bik universālāk iekš SQL iznesties (nu i kaut ko vērtīgu pie reizes apgūt).
  7. Ir nepieciešamība izveikt šādu darbību starp 2 datubāzēm MySQL5.

     

    Dots: Tabula

    AutoNR (Auto_Increment)

    Vards (varchar)

    Uzvards (varchar)

    Adrese (varchar)

    ...

    Info (varchar)

     

    Vajag konkrētu info pārnest uz citu DB.Tabulu

     

    INSERT INTO Datubaze2.Tabula

    SELECT Vards,Uzvards,Adrese,...,Info FROM Datubaze1.Tabula

    WHERE AutoNR = 5;

     

    Jautājums:

    1. Kā šādam vaicājumam pateikt, ka AutoNR = NULL, jo AutoNR numerācija nesakrīt starp DB?

    2. Kā iespējams ņemt no 1.DB un INSERTot 2.DB izlaist kaut ko, piemēram "Adrese", lai nebļautu, ka kolonnu skaits nesakrīt?

     

    Paldies

  8. Visam tam, kas ir kreisajā pusē, jābūt float'otam pa kreisi, netikai bildei, bet arī elementam, kurā ir teksts (tas nozīmē, ka teksts tev jāieliek elemetā, kuram float: left).

    Iespējams, vienkāršāk būtu taisīt #striipa ar position relative un #pa-labi, #pa-kreisi ar position absolute, attiecīgi norādot left: 0 un right: 0.

    Paldies, izklausās baigi nopietni un pareizi.
  9. Vajag vienā 500px garā <div> katrā galā ielikt pa mazai bildītei.

    Kreisā puse OK, bet labājā pusē pareizi tikai IE8, FF, Safari rāda, bet IE6 u.tml. <craps> uztaisa newline un tad novieto bildīti labajā pusē jaunā rindā... :(

     

    <div id="striipa">

    Teksts vai bilde pa kreisi. = OK.

    <img id="pa-labi" src="bilde.png" height="12" alt="bilde">

    </div>

     

    CSS šāds:

    #pa-labi {

    float: right;

    margin: 0px;

    padding: 0px;

    }

     

    Kā samācīt IE6 rādīt normāli?

    Paldies

  10. Beidzot uzrāvos uz nepatīkamu lietu :(

    1. Uztaisām failu tst.php, iekšā:

    <?

    print_r($_GET);

    ?>

     

    2. Atveram pārlūkā ar šādiem mainīgajiem: tst.php?r.r=4

     

    3. Dabūjam:

    Array ( [r_r] => 4 )

     

    WTF punkts par _ tiek pārtaisīts?

     

    Paldies!

  11. Dots:

    vairāki šādi linki ar bilde + teksts, bilde + teksts ... vienā rindā:

    [bilde]links1 [bilde]links2 [bilde]links3 ... [bilde]links9

     

    <a href="xxx1.php"><img src="aa.png" hspace=10 vspace=10 border=0 alt="aa">links1</a>
    <a href="xxx2.php"><img src="aa.png" hspace=10 vspace=10 border=0 alt="aa">links2</a> 
    ...
    <a href="xxx9.php"><img src="aa.png" hspace=10 vspace=10 border=0 alt="aa">links9</a>

    Kā panākt, lai samazinot logu pa vidu bilde nedalītos nost no teksta, bet būtu vienmēr kopā bilde + teksts?

     

    Ar <div>, <span>, <p> galos neizdevās, samazinot logu, notiek tā:

     

    [bilde]links1 [bilde]links2 [bilde]

    links3 ... [bilde]links9

     

    Bet vajag tā:

    [bilde]links1 [bilde]links2

    [bilde]links3 ... [bilde]links9

  12. Interesē ģenerēt X,Y 2dimensiju chart bildi. Kādus pļuginus labāk izmantot? Ko tauta lieto?

    Vajadzība ir bez vipendroniem, piemēram, X - datums, Y - kaut kāda vērība --> JPG.

×
×
  • Create New...